•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

ne işe yarar

yuxexes

Altın Üye
Katılım
17 Mayıs 2007
Mesajlar
32
Excel Vers. ve Dili
excel-2016
Private Sub Worksheet_Change(ByVal Target As Range)
If Intersect(Target, Range("B3:B65536")) Is Nothing Then Exit Sub
If (WorksheetFunction.CountIf(Range("A:A"), Cells(Target.Row, 1)) > 1 And _
WorksheetFunction.CountIf(Range("B:B"), Cells(Target.Row, 2)) > 1) Or _
WorksheetFunction.CountIf(Range("F:F"), Cells(Target.Row, 2)) < 1 Then
MsgBox "OLMAYAN BİR CİHAZ NUMARASI GİRDİNİZ VEYA AYNI TARİHE, AYNI CİHAZ NUMARASI" & vbCrLf & _
"İLE İKİNCİ KEZ GİRİŞ YAPIYORSUNUZ. SLİPLERDEN SATIŞLARI KONTROL EDİNİZ.", , "DİKKAT"
Target = ""
Target.Activate
End If
End Sub


merhaba;
yukarıdaki kodların ne işe yaradığını aşama aşama bana tarif edebilecek bir arkadaş varmı.
bir hata varda çözmek istiyorum ve yardımlarınızı rica ediyorum.

şimdiden teşekkür ederim.
 
ne yapmak istiyorsun onu soylesende ona gore calısma yapabilsek daha iyi olmazmı ek dosya gonderseniz sorunuzu orada sorsanız iyi olur diye dusunurum haksızmıyım gerci daha iyisini siz bilirsiniz ama saygılar :)
 
ekli dosya

merhaba;
dosya ekte ve az önce gönderdiğim kodda kayıtlı.
benim istediğim a hücresine tarih girmek b hücresine cihaz no seçmek ve tutar bölümü olan c hücresinede tutar girmek.
benim istediğim veri girişi yaparken aynı tarihle aynı cihaz nosu girdiğimde hata mesajı versin.
bunu ilk satırda yapıyor ancak bir iki tarih girdikten sonra farklı tarihlerde bile girsem. aynı cihaz no girdiğimde hata veriyor.
yardımlarınızı rica ediyorum.
 

Ekli dosyalar

Geri
Üst